Output 3c980d887502c078918232057f01ed32bc9ef22dea6b037d53b33c7f3330d10e:0

value
6308462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a423b42374a6b8cd132b86b2c7985fff0be1cbd OP_EQUAL
address
3EJ4WrqxSGe1JMDa3HjqMPXSedEe6t345q
transaction
3c980d887502c078918232057f01ed32bc9ef22dea6b037d53b33c7f3330d10e
spent
true